"Hey y'all, I just landed a dev role at a Web3 startup last year and I gotta say, it wasn't as easy as everyone makes it out to be. I had to build a whole portfolio of personal projects before I could even get noticed by hiring managers. Networking was key for me, too - I made connections at conferences and online communities."

"Hey guys, just wanted to throw in my 2 cents - I landed a Dev Ops role at a decentralized data storage company by networking at a local Blockchain conference. It was super helpful to have a tangible project under my belt, so if you're looking to get your foot in the door, try working on some personal projects related to Web3 and sharing them on LinkedIn or GitHub."
